#dbdfe9 - Winter Ice color

This pale, cool tone reads as a soft blue-gray with a faint lavender undertone, like a misted morning sky or porcelain touched by winter light. It feels airy, understated and calming—an elegant neutral with a subtle coolness rather than true white. Ideal for minimalist interiors, serene bedrooms, and refined backgrounds, it pairs beautifully with warm woods, deep navy, muted mauves, or crisp whites to create contrast. It brings gentle sophistication and tranquility without feeling sterile or overly cold.

#dbdfe9 color RGB value is 219, 223, 233, and the CMYK value is 0.0601, 0.0429, 0.00, 0.0863. Alternative names for that color are: winter ice, white, gainsboro, link water, violet.
